A Commentary.This critically acclaimed series provides fresh
and authoritative treatments of important aspects of Old Testament study
through commentaries and general surveys. The contributors are scholars of
international standing. (= 0664208630 / 9780664208639)'Mays provides an extensive treatment of the book from a moderately critical
perspective. He presents philological and other technical analyses, but he does
not lose sight of the theological message of the book.' - Tremper
